A DSCP-based method of QoS class mapping between WLAN and EPS network

Abstract

In recent years the developments of wireless and mobile networks are particularly prominent. In order to provide users with better services over these heterogeneous networks, QoS needs to be considered. In this paper, we analyze the QoS features of LTE and WLAN respectively. Then we propose a DSCP-based method of QoS class mapping between WLAN and EPS network, and simulate the QoS class mapping method in OPNET. By analyzing the experiments, we consider that this method is feasible and effective. Finally we present the conclusion.
